ok, now that you've settled on building a "classic", let's make sure you do it right. It would be quite irresponsible for myself, and others on this board to not address the most important part of hopping up any car, but especially old Stangs.......Suspension and BRAKES.

I know it's not glamorous, and it's hard to brag to your buddies about putting in new strut rod bushings or ball joints, but it is are absolutely essential that the car handle and stop well and to do it consistantly. You really need disc brakes up front.......four wheel discs are great, but you really just need to make sure the rear drums are in good operating condition.

It's easy to get going fast, and it can happen in a big hurry once you get into the 250+ hp range, and you need to know that the car can slow down and make that emergency lane change when somebody in front of you does something unexpected. Please don't overlook this part, we would all hate to see something happen to you.

Now for the fun stuff......MORE POWER. God wouldn't have given us gobs of tire-frying torque and horse power unless he intended us to use it.

My advice.....put in a 5.0 (roller cams are wonderful inventions), stick a five speed behind it, buy some 3.80 gears(closest thing to 3.73's you'll find for that 8" rear), top with fresh basil and garlic, bake for 45 minutes at 400 degrees and ....ooops, wrong recipe......put a dual plane intake and 600 cfm carb on top, use 1 5/8" headers and enjoy. Yes you will go through tires quickly, but you just have to budget for that.

Best advice about driving fast.....learn when and where to do it. It doesn't belong everywhere, and the cops will surely remind you of that fact. Don't get me wrong, I drive my car on the street every day, sometimes much faster than I should, but I will NEVER drive stupid on a residential street, and I won't open it up unless I have a good open road without traffic.
